为 rails 上的嵌入图像获取 URL
Get URL for embedded image on rails
我创建了一个认证平台,每当用户获得认证时 he/she 都会获得徽章图像 link 添加到 his/her 网站。
当他们这样做时,我会在我的服务器端生成图像。因此,如果他们添加图像 url http://mycertification.com/badges/asdfasdfasdfasdf.jpg
,它会在我这边检查图像是否已创建并 return 它,如果没有,则创建一个新图像。
我现在有超过 10000 名认证用户,我想检查他们是否嵌入了徽章以及徽章嵌入的位置。因此,如果来自网站 www.user1.com 的用户在该网站上嵌入了徽章图像,我想对其进行跟踪。
我用 user_id
、url
和 counter
创建了一个模型 BadgeTracker
。就那么简单。计数器已经工作了,现在我想知道嵌入图像的URL!
关于如何实现这一点有什么想法吗?
据我所知,如果用户将嵌入代码放在他们的网站上,则无法跟踪。您只能跟踪徽章在浏览器中被查看(意味着加载)的次数。如果是这种情况,那么您可以创建一个处理徽章显示的路由,因此一旦浏览器尝试访问此 URL 您就可以从参数中收集徽章信息,将其保存在数据库中,然后只需 return徽章图像。对不起,如果我错了你的问题......
如果您有兴趣,我可以尝试使用该解决方案创建一个代码片段。
我创建了一个认证平台,每当用户获得认证时 he/she 都会获得徽章图像 link 添加到 his/her 网站。
当他们这样做时,我会在我的服务器端生成图像。因此,如果他们添加图像 url http://mycertification.com/badges/asdfasdfasdfasdf.jpg
,它会在我这边检查图像是否已创建并 return 它,如果没有,则创建一个新图像。
我现在有超过 10000 名认证用户,我想检查他们是否嵌入了徽章以及徽章嵌入的位置。因此,如果来自网站 www.user1.com 的用户在该网站上嵌入了徽章图像,我想对其进行跟踪。
我用 user_id
、url
和 counter
创建了一个模型 BadgeTracker
。就那么简单。计数器已经工作了,现在我想知道嵌入图像的URL!
关于如何实现这一点有什么想法吗?
据我所知,如果用户将嵌入代码放在他们的网站上,则无法跟踪。您只能跟踪徽章在浏览器中被查看(意味着加载)的次数。如果是这种情况,那么您可以创建一个处理徽章显示的路由,因此一旦浏览器尝试访问此 URL 您就可以从参数中收集徽章信息,将其保存在数据库中,然后只需 return徽章图像。对不起,如果我错了你的问题...... 如果您有兴趣,我可以尝试使用该解决方案创建一个代码片段。